We’re excited to announce that Sean Macdonald will be returning to the line-up for Friday night’s game against the Brisbane Bullets, replacing Lachlan Barker. Sean has been back in full training with the team for a good while now, and his progress has exceeded our expectations thanks to his relentless work both on and off the floor.
Head Physiotherapist Ryan Carroll confirms Sean's been making daily improvements, noting that it’s been about eight and a half weeks since his ankle injury in Singapore. After traveling with the team on a recent 10-day road trip, Sean was able to participate in full training and has been around the group, which has been invaluable for his recovery. We’re pleased to see Sean back on the floor and suiting up with our guys tomorrow night.
